网站优化

网站优化

Products

当前位置:首页 > 网站优化 >

学习Java9,我能掌握哪些前沿特性,提升开发效率?

GG网络技术分享 2025-11-18 13:08 0


Java9的模块系统:简化开发和维护

变量值为你自己安装jdk的文件目录这里要注意。

变量名:JAVA_HOME 变量值:C:\Program Files\Java\jdk1..0

变量名:CLASSPATH 变量值:.;%JAVA_HOME%\lib\dt.jar;%JAVA_HOME%\lib\tools.jar;

模块化系统是基于jar包和类之间存在的, 目的在于尽兴许的少许些jar中许多余类的加载,保证整体项目运行时的效率,对于项目运行一准儿有一定的积极意义。

Java9的JShell:交互式编程体验

Java 9 的这些个新鲜特性不仅提升了开发效率, 还为新潮化开发给了geng有力巨大的工具支持,是 Java 平台进步的关键里程碑! 访问控制:模块Neng决定哪些包对外可见。

这其实吧意味着以后的hen长远一段时候,你dou不Neng在库中运用 Java 9所给的新鲜特性。2002年2月26日 J2SE1.4发布,此后Java的计算Neng力有了巨大幅提升; 在介绍 java9之前,我们先来kankanjava成立到眼下的全部版本。

Java9的HTTP/2支持:geng迅速的数据传输

接下来我们从Java9开头介绍他的新鲜特性, 一直到Java14,话不许多说迅速上车吧。可简化各种类库和巨大型应用的开发和维护, 改进 Java SE平台,使其Neng习惯不同巨大细小的计算设备,改进其平安性,可维护性,搞优良性Neng。

相信眼下hen许多Java开发人员基本上用的Java版本还是以Java 8为主, 虽然Java 9、Java 10、Java 11、Java 12、Java 13Yi经推出了有一段时候。

Java9的Spring Boot:飞迅速搭建Web应用

Spring Boot 基于 Spring Framework, 给了 异步非阻塞 IO 的响应式 Stream、非堵塞的函数式 Reactive Web 框架 Spring WebFlux等特性。hen许多用过SpringBoot的人dou晓得, 用SpringBoot搭建Web应用真实的是又迅速又优良,相信Spring Boot 2会带来geng许多惊喜。

Java 9 给了超出 150 项新鲜功Neng特性, 包括备受期待的模块化系统、可交互的 REPL工具:jshell、JDK编译工具、Java公共 API和私有代码,以及平安增有力、 提升、性Neng管理改善等。

Java9的ShenandoahGC:geng高大效的垃圾回收

掌握Java的Zui新鲜特性, 不仅Neng够提升开发效率,还Neng使代码geng加平安、可靠。密封类是Java 17中的一个关键特性,它允许类或接口管束哪些其他类或接口Neng继承或实现它们。本文将详细介绍Java的Zui新鲜特性,并给实用的升级攻略,帮开发者全面掌握Java,提升开发效率。

Java9的

标签:

提交需求或反馈

Demand feedback